Oliver Heaviside: السيرة الذاتية والإنجازات والإرث الدائم

Oliver Heaviside ( HEV-ee-syde; 18 May 1850 – 3 February 1925) was a British mathematician and electrical engineer who invented a new technique for solving differential equations (equivalent to the Laplace transform), independently developed vector calculus, and rewrote Maxwell's equations in the form commonly used today. He significantly shaped the way Maxwell's equations were understood and applied in the decades following Maxwell's death. Also, in 1893, he extended them to gravitoelectromagnetism, which was confirmed by Gravity Probe B in 2005. His formulation of the telegrapher's equations became commercially important during his own lifetime, after their significance went unremarked for a long while, as few others were versed at the time in his novel methodology. Although at odds with the scientific establishment for most of his life, Heaviside changed the face of telecommunications, mathematics, and science.

The influence of Oliver Heaviside extends far beyond his own lifetime. He fundamentally shaped the foundations of modern mathematics, and his theorems and mathematical frameworks remain foundational to this day.

Though he passed away in 1925, his ideas continue to be studied, debated, and built upon by scholars and practitioners worldwide.
